# Salesforce Marketing Cloud — CRM Contact Sync

> Set up an on-demand data sync to push and sync contacts from Komo to Salesforce Marketing Cloud.

## What is it?

You can now have confidence that the contact data within your Salesforce Marketing Cloud CRM is up-to-date with CRM Contact Sync. Through direct integration with your Salesforce Marketing Cloud instance, the Komo Engagement Engine can now push new contacts and contact updates directly to Salesforce Marketing Cloud, on-demand, so you can eliminate manual and painful contact management processes.

## How do I set it up?

### Step 1: Connect to Marketing Cloud and Create a Data Extension

* Navigate to **Account Settings** by clicking the **Workspace initials** in the top right corner and clicking **Account Settings**.
* **(1)** Click **Connected Apps**.
* **(2)** Select **Connect** next to the Salesforce Marketing Cloud Connected App.

* **(A)** Here you can insert the **CRM Domain Name** from your CRM instance.
* **(B)** Insert the **Client ID/consumer key** from the connected CRM.
* **(C)** Here you can paste in the **Client Secret** of the connected CRM.
* **(D)** Click **Test** under Test Connection. If the connection is successful, you will see a green **Connection Successful** message.
* **(E)** Click **Connect**.

Now, you'll want to create a Data Extension in Marketing Cloud. This is where the Komo Engagement Engine will push Contacts. [Follow these instructions](https://help.salesforce.com/s/articleView?id=sf.mc_cab_create_a_new_data_extension.htm\&language=en_US\&type=5) to create your Data Extension.

  In order to connect to Salesforce Marketing, you need to create an Installed Package in Salesforce Marketing Cloud. Then add a Component of type API Integration. Make sure you use the Server-to-Server type. For information on how to set this up visit [Salesforce help](https://help.salesforce.com/s/articleView?id=sf.connected_app_create_api_integration.htm\&type=5) or contact your Customer Success Manager.

## FAQ

**Is the CRM Contact Sync a two-way sync (ie. push and pull)?**

At this stage, the CRM Contact sync is a one way sync (push) from the Komo Engagement Engine to the CRM. This means that any updates to contacts within the Komo Engagement Engine will automatically be pushed to the CRM to ensure the CRM remains in sync with the changes made in Komo. In the instance where a contact is updated in the CRM initially, the change will not be reflected in the Komo Engagement Engine. We will be rolling out a true two-way (push and pull) sync in a future release.

**How often will the CRM Contact Sync run?**

The sync is completely on-demand so you can run the sync as often or as little as you require. To do so, you simply need to click **Sync now** as detailed in [**Step 4.**](/crm/syncs/salesforce-crm-contact-sync#step-4)

**Is this available for all CRMs?**

At this stage, the CRM Contact Sync has only been rolled out for Salesforce and Salesforce Marketing Cloud. We will be rolling out this functionality for additional CRMs in the near future.

**Can this be managed by all users?**

The CRM Contact Sync can only be managed by Super Users at this point in time. We will be making this functionality available to additional users in the near future.

**How many CRM Contact Syncs can I create?**

You can create as many different syncs as you require!
